Why Outsource Game Development?
- Cost Efficiency: By outsourcing, companies can take advantage of lower labor costs in different regions while maintaining the quality of work. This allows studios to allocate budgets effectively across various projects.
- Access to Expertise: Partnering with established outsourcing game studios enables access to a diverse pool of talent, including professionals with specialized skills in areas such as graphics, programming, and game design.
- Scalability: Outsourcing offers the flexibility to scale teams up or down based on project demands, allowing businesses to adapt quickly to changing requirements.
- Focus on Core Competencies: By delegating game development tasks, studios can focus on their primary business objectives, such as marketing, storytelling, and player engagement.
Choosing the Right Outsourcing Game Studio
When it comes to outsourcing game studios, selecting the right partner is crucial for success. Here are the factors to consider:
1. Portfolio and Experience
Examine the studio’s portfolio to assess their experience and the quality of their previous work. Look for a diverse range of completed projects and positive client testimonials that highlight their capabilities and reliability.
2. Technical Proficiency
Ensure that the outsourcing game studio has the technical expertise needed to meet your project requirements. This includes familiarity with various platforms, tools, and technologies relevant to your game design.
3. Communication Skills
Effective communication is vital in game development. Choose a studio that demonstrates clear and open communication, keeping you informed at every stage of the project and facilitating collaboration.
4. Cultural Compatibility
Consider the cultural fit between your team and the outsourcing game studio. Understanding differences in work ethics, time zones, and communication styles can help foster a productive working relationship.

Best Practices for Effective Collaboration
1. Set Clear Goals and Expectations
At the outset of the project, communicate your goals, expectations, and deadlines clearly. Risk management and quality assurance should be part of the initial discussions to align both teams on common objectives.
2. Establish a Strong Communication Protocol
Regular updates and check-ins can prevent misunderstandings and keep the project on track. Utilize project management tools to facilitate smooth communication and tracking of progress.
3. Foster a Collaborative Environment
Encourage collaboration between your in-house team and the outsourcing studio. Joint brainstorming sessions and shared resources can enhance creativity and camaraderie, leading to a more successful project outcome.
4. Evaluate and Provide Constructive Feedback
Continuous evaluation throughout the development process is essential. Providing constructive feedback helps the outsourcing studio understand your preferences and align their work with your vision.
